as of march 1 all new duct systems must pass duct blaster test. how long does this normally take and is there any certain duct blaster better than others?:cheers:

Duct tests usually take about an hour depending on how many registers there are.
I've used the Minneapolis Duct Blaster many times. Always worked perfect for me.
